WASHINGTON -- In a series of warning letters to compounding pharmacies across the country, the Food and Drug Administration has asserted a policy that the International Academy of Compounding Pharmacists (IACP) charges would deny hundreds of thousands of women access to many compounded bioidentical hormones.
Hormone replacement is prescribed to relieve hot flashes and other symptoms resulting from the loss of estrogen in women who are undergoing menopause.
"The FDA is concerned that the claims for safety, effectiveness and superiority that these pharmacy operations are making may mislead patients as well as doctors and other health care professionals," ...
